Study in Germany: Scholarships for Pakistani Students
Why Study in Germany?
Germany offers world-class education with low or no tuition fees at public universities. Pakistani students can benefit from a wide range of fully or partially funded scholarships to make studying affordable and achievable.
Top Scholarship Opportunities
- DAAD Scholarships: Offered by the German Academic Exchange Service for master’s and PhD programs.
- Heinrich Böll Foundation: For highly qualified students who are politically and socially engaged.
- Erasmus+ Program: Offers exchange and full-degree scholarships in collaboration with German institutions.
- Konrad-Adenauer-Stiftung (KAS): Available for students with strong academic and leadership skills.
Basic Requirements
- Good academic record (minimum 3.0 GPA recommended)
- Language proficiency (IELTS or German language skills, depending on the program)
- Motivation letter and research proposal (for graduate studies)
- Valid passport and educational documents
Application Tips
Start your preparation early. Visit the DAAD official website for up-to-date scholarships and deadlines. Tailor your application for each program and get your documents attested properly.
